概要:
MQ框架非常之多,比较流行的有RabbitMq、ActiveMq、ZeroMq、kafka。这几种MQ到底应该选择哪个?要根据自己项目的业务场景和需求。下面我列出这些MQ之间的对比数据和资料。
详细内容请看我的csdn博客:
RabbitMq、ActiveMq、ZeroMq、kafka之间的比较,资料汇总
您还没有登录,请您登录后再发表评论
#### Kafka与Activemq、Rabbitmq、ZeroMq、Rocketmq的比较 在现代分布式系统中,消息中间件(Message Queue, MQ)扮演着至关重要的角色,它们用于在分布式组件之间传输消息,帮助解决网络延迟、组件故障等问题,...
常用的消息队列有 ActiveMQ、RabbitMQ、ZeroMQ、Kafka、MetaMQ、RocketMQ 等。 Java 消息队列的应用场景: 1. 异步处理:引入消息队列,将不是必须的业务逻辑异步处理,解决系统性能瓶颈问题。 2. 应用解耦:引入...
消息中间件技术选型,ActiveMQ、Apollo、RabbitMQ、RocketMQ、Kafka、Redis、ZeroMQ多维护对比分析
按照目前网络上的资料,RabbitMQ 、activeM 、ZeroMQ 三者中,综合来看,RabbitMQ 是首选。 2.持久化消息比较 ZeroMq 不支持,ActiveMq 和RabbitMq 都支持。持久化消息主要是指我们机器在不可抗力因素等情况下挂掉...
当前使用较多的消息中间件有RabbitMQ、RocketMQ、ActiveMQ、Kafka、ZeroMQ、MetaMQ等。本套视频以Apache的ActiveMQ作为切入点,分为基础/实战/面试上中下三大部分,带你从零基础入门到熟练掌握ActiveMQ,能够结合...
当前使用较多的消息中间件有RabbitMQ、RocketMQ、ActiveMQ、Kafka、ZeroMQ、MetaMQ等, 本次以Apache的ActiveMQ作为切入点,分为基础/实战/面试上中下三大部分,将带着同学们 从零基础入门到熟练掌握ActiveMQ,能够...
目前市场上主流的消息队列产品包括ActiveMQ、ZeroMQ、RabbitMQ、RocketMQ和Kafka。其中,ActiveMQ基于JMS协议,而ZeroMQ是基于C语言开发,RabbitMQ基于AMQP协议并使用Erlang语言编写,RocketMQ是阿里巴巴基于JMS协议...
RabbitMQ作为一个中间件,本质上是一个消息的代理,在这个领域还有ActiveMQ、RocketMQ、 ZeroMQ、Joram、Kafka等等。其中ActiveMQ是Apache公司开源的消息系统,使用Java语言开发,功能 较为完善,被大量开源项目所...
在这些方面,**RabbitMQ和Kafka表现最佳**,而ActiveMQ略逊一筹,ZeroMQ则相对较弱。 ##### 3.4 高并发能力 RabbitMQ之所以能在高并发场景下表现出色,很大程度上得益于其实现语言——**Erlang**。Erlang是一门...
虽然市场上有多种消息中间件,如ActiveMQ、RabbitMQ、ZeroMQ、MetaMQ、RocketMQ等,但Kafka以其高吞吐量、低延迟和可持久化特性,在大数据处理和实时流应用中脱颖而出。 四、Kafka在电商系统中的应用 电商系统中,...
在当前的消息中间件产品市场中,存在多种选择,包括ActiveMQ、RabbitMQ、RocketMQ、Kafka、ZeroMQ等。每种产品都有其优缺点,本文将对这些产品进行比较,阐述Kafka集群方案选型的必要性和可行性。 一、消息中间件...
目前市场上较为流行的消息队列框架包括RabbitMQ、ActiveMQ、ZeroMQ、Kafka以及阿里巴巴开源的RocketMQ等。本教程将重点介绍RabbitMQ及其使用方法。 #### RabbitMQ简介 RabbitMQ是一个开源的消息代理软件,基于...
### rabbitMQ文档 #### MQ(消息队列)概述 **MQ**,即**Message Queue**(消息队列),是一种在分布式系统中实现进程间通信的技术。消息队列本质上是一个先进先出(FIFO)的数据结构,用于存储消息直到被消费。...
在本文档中,我们将对以下十种消息队列(Message Queue,简称MQ)系统进行详细的技术选型对比:ActiveMQ、RabbitMQ、RocketMQ、Joram、HornetQ、OpenMQ、MuleMQ、SonicMQ、ZeroMQ以及Kafka。这些系统在企业级应用中...
同时,Kafka相比于RabbitMQ、ZeroMQ、ActiveMQ和Redis等其他消息队列(MQ),它在处理大规模数据流方面有其独特的优势。 总的来说,Kafka的核心特点在于它能够提供非常高的吞吐量,消息持久化,便于水平扩展,以及...
本文将围绕标题"消息队列1"和描述中的内容,探讨几个主流的消息队列系统,包括Kafka、RabbitMQ、ZeroMQ和RocketMQ,以及它们在可用性、开发语言、协议支持、消息存储、事务处理和负载均衡等方面的特点。 首先,...
在比较RabbitMQ与其他主流消息队列产品时,如ActiveMQ、ZeroMQ和Kafka等,需要考虑消息协议、产品特性、使用场景等多个方面。RabbitMQ基于高级消息队列协议(AMQP),而其他产品可能基于不同的协议,如ZeroMQ基于TCP...
相关推荐
#### Kafka与Activemq、Rabbitmq、ZeroMq、Rocketmq的比较 在现代分布式系统中,消息中间件(Message Queue, MQ)扮演着至关重要的角色,它们用于在分布式组件之间传输消息,帮助解决网络延迟、组件故障等问题,...
常用的消息队列有 ActiveMQ、RabbitMQ、ZeroMQ、Kafka、MetaMQ、RocketMQ 等。 Java 消息队列的应用场景: 1. 异步处理:引入消息队列,将不是必须的业务逻辑异步处理,解决系统性能瓶颈问题。 2. 应用解耦:引入...
消息中间件技术选型,ActiveMQ、Apollo、RabbitMQ、RocketMQ、Kafka、Redis、ZeroMQ多维护对比分析
按照目前网络上的资料,RabbitMQ 、activeM 、ZeroMQ 三者中,综合来看,RabbitMQ 是首选。 2.持久化消息比较 ZeroMq 不支持,ActiveMq 和RabbitMq 都支持。持久化消息主要是指我们机器在不可抗力因素等情况下挂掉...
当前使用较多的消息中间件有RabbitMQ、RocketMQ、ActiveMQ、Kafka、ZeroMQ、MetaMQ等。本套视频以Apache的ActiveMQ作为切入点,分为基础/实战/面试上中下三大部分,带你从零基础入门到熟练掌握ActiveMQ,能够结合...
当前使用较多的消息中间件有RabbitMQ、RocketMQ、ActiveMQ、Kafka、ZeroMQ、MetaMQ等, 本次以Apache的ActiveMQ作为切入点,分为基础/实战/面试上中下三大部分,将带着同学们 从零基础入门到熟练掌握ActiveMQ,能够...
目前市场上主流的消息队列产品包括ActiveMQ、ZeroMQ、RabbitMQ、RocketMQ和Kafka。其中,ActiveMQ基于JMS协议,而ZeroMQ是基于C语言开发,RabbitMQ基于AMQP协议并使用Erlang语言编写,RocketMQ是阿里巴巴基于JMS协议...
RabbitMQ作为一个中间件,本质上是一个消息的代理,在这个领域还有ActiveMQ、RocketMQ、 ZeroMQ、Joram、Kafka等等。其中ActiveMQ是Apache公司开源的消息系统,使用Java语言开发,功能 较为完善,被大量开源项目所...
在这些方面,**RabbitMQ和Kafka表现最佳**,而ActiveMQ略逊一筹,ZeroMQ则相对较弱。 ##### 3.4 高并发能力 RabbitMQ之所以能在高并发场景下表现出色,很大程度上得益于其实现语言——**Erlang**。Erlang是一门...
虽然市场上有多种消息中间件,如ActiveMQ、RabbitMQ、ZeroMQ、MetaMQ、RocketMQ等,但Kafka以其高吞吐量、低延迟和可持久化特性,在大数据处理和实时流应用中脱颖而出。 四、Kafka在电商系统中的应用 电商系统中,...
在当前的消息中间件产品市场中,存在多种选择,包括ActiveMQ、RabbitMQ、RocketMQ、Kafka、ZeroMQ等。每种产品都有其优缺点,本文将对这些产品进行比较,阐述Kafka集群方案选型的必要性和可行性。 一、消息中间件...
目前市场上较为流行的消息队列框架包括RabbitMQ、ActiveMQ、ZeroMQ、Kafka以及阿里巴巴开源的RocketMQ等。本教程将重点介绍RabbitMQ及其使用方法。 #### RabbitMQ简介 RabbitMQ是一个开源的消息代理软件,基于...
### rabbitMQ文档 #### MQ(消息队列)概述 **MQ**,即**Message Queue**(消息队列),是一种在分布式系统中实现进程间通信的技术。消息队列本质上是一个先进先出(FIFO)的数据结构,用于存储消息直到被消费。...
在本文档中,我们将对以下十种消息队列(Message Queue,简称MQ)系统进行详细的技术选型对比:ActiveMQ、RabbitMQ、RocketMQ、Joram、HornetQ、OpenMQ、MuleMQ、SonicMQ、ZeroMQ以及Kafka。这些系统在企业级应用中...
同时,Kafka相比于RabbitMQ、ZeroMQ、ActiveMQ和Redis等其他消息队列(MQ),它在处理大规模数据流方面有其独特的优势。 总的来说,Kafka的核心特点在于它能够提供非常高的吞吐量,消息持久化,便于水平扩展,以及...
本文将围绕标题"消息队列1"和描述中的内容,探讨几个主流的消息队列系统,包括Kafka、RabbitMQ、ZeroMQ和RocketMQ,以及它们在可用性、开发语言、协议支持、消息存储、事务处理和负载均衡等方面的特点。 首先,...
在比较RabbitMQ与其他主流消息队列产品时,如ActiveMQ、ZeroMQ和Kafka等,需要考虑消息协议、产品特性、使用场景等多个方面。RabbitMQ基于高级消息队列协议(AMQP),而其他产品可能基于不同的协议,如ZeroMQ基于TCP...